Transaction 51034eb7943225299e987089eb04d41978b3f0dcac347a59e704225b33a8f10d
1 Input
2 Outputs
- 51034eb7943225299e987089eb04d41978b3f0dcac347a59e704225b33a8f10d:0
- 51034eb7943225299e987089eb04d41978b3f0dcac347a59e704225b33a8f10d:1
value 62381
address 1Bi6Zx9DP1Uye4UoMSqPzesocLho1VR58z
value 769616
address 1AHPJFbe27Uo872DqtRPECV5xmKvDczFtV